This report outlines the use of Google Drive for accessing and sharing Korean dramas (K-dramas), a practice often used by fans seeking free or downloadable content outside of official streaming platforms. Overview of K-Dramas on Google Drive

Unlike the transactional nature of a subscription service, the KDrama Google Drive ecosystem operates on a gift economy. Fans—often "fansubbers"—dedicate hours to ripping, subtitling, and uploading high-definition files to shared drives. These links are then circulated in closed forums, Telegram groups, or social media circles. This practice fosters a sense of communal ownership; the content isn't just something consumed, but something protected and shared by the collective.
